web-dev-qa-db-ja.com

(SC)DeleteServiceが失敗しました1072

前回WASプロファイルとWASServiceを作成してから、WASを構成する方法を学ぶために多くのスクリプトを構成して実行しようとしました。

今、services.mscリストでIBM Webphere Application Serverサービスの表示を見つけたので、WASService.exe -removeコマンドとwindows SCコマンドで削除しようとしましたが、メッセージが表示されました

C:\Program Files\IBM\WebSphere\AppServer\bin>sc delete "IBMWAS61Service - DEV"
[SC] DeleteService FAILED 1072:
The specified service has been marked for deletion.
95
Fuangwith S.

サービスが停止されていること、サービスコントロールパネルが閉じられていること、開いているファイルハンドルがサービスによって開かれていないことを確認してください。

また、ProcessExplorerが実行されていないことを確認してください。

185
StingyJack

同様の問題があり、それを克服するためにしたことは次のとおりです。

  1. サービスを停止します。net stop "ServiceName"
  2. 確認:「mmc.exe」プロセスが存在しない(「サービス」リストウィンドウ):taskkill/F/IM mmc.exe
  3. サービスを削除します。sc delete "ServiceName"

    C:\server>sc delete "ServiceName"
    
    [SC] DeleteService SUCCESS
    

ここで、別のscコマンドを実行すると、次の結果が得られます。

C:\server>sc delete "ServiceName"

[SC] OpenService FAILED 1060:

The specified service does not exist as an installed service.

しかし、1072エラーメッセージではありません

81
Tate

私がやったことは、regeditのこの場所に行くことです。

HKEY_LOCAL_MACHINE/SYSTEM/CurrentControlSet/Services

ここから、マシン上のすべてのサービスのフォルダーが表示されます。目的のサービスのフォルダーを削除するだけで完了です。

N.B:これを試す前にサービスを停止してください。

22
Onion-Knight

同じ問題がありました。 [コンピューターの管理]ウィンドウを閉じて再度開いた後、リストからサービスが削除されました。 Windows 7を実行しています

8
Rob

バグがある理由のために、イベントビューアとServices.mscの両方が、指示されたときに適切なrefreshを実行しません。

それらを閉じて再起動すると、サービスは削除されます。

4
Fandango68

Windows 7では、削除する前にイベントビューアーが閉じていることを確認してください。

3
lsalamon

サービス名のタイプミスにより同じエラーが発生しました。サービス名の代わりにサービス表示名を削除しようとしていました。適切なサービス名を使用すると、問題なく機能しました

1
Rahamat

ログアウトして再度ログインすると、すべてのブロッキングアプリが閉じられ、問題が解決します。

1
vahapt

このエラーも発生しました。サービスが指しているexeが停止していることを確認してください。また、他のウィンドウの背後にWindowsダイアログボックスがないことを確認してください。それが私の削除ではなかった理由です。このサービスが削除されたか、または類似したものがあったことを示すWindowsメッセージが背後にありました。[OK]をクリックするだけで、そこに行きました。

1
germs

サードパーティのアプリケーションアンインストーラーはサービスのファイルを削除し、サービスをこの保留中の削除状態のままにしました。

すべてのアプリケーションを閉じて、強制終了するサービスのPIDを識別し(他のすべてのユーザーをログオフし、ログオフしてからログオンし直した後)、リブートするだけで解決しました。

1
rob